Binding Characters Analysis Of Odorant Binding Proteins From Agrilus Zanthoxylumi

Abstract/Summary:
Agrilus zanthoxylum,a destructive borer of Zanthoxylum bungeanum,was first reported in 1988.However,due to its hidden symptoms,physical control and chemical control with single application had little effect,which makd it difficult to prevent and control.Olfactory recognition mechanism is very important for host identification,but it has not been fully understood in this pest.Odor-binding protein plays an irreplaceable role in the life process of the localized host of A.zanthoxylum.As the first reaction in the olfactory recognition process of insects,odor-binding protein was the first to capture hydrophobic odor molecules and transfered them to sensory lymph.In this study,three odor-binding proteins of A.zanthoxylum were expressed,purified and predicted by bioinformatics and molecular biology methods,and the binding characteristics between odor-binding protein AzanOBPs and host volatiles were analyzed.The main results were follows:1.The full-length sequences of three odor binding protein genes(AzanOBP4,AzanOBP5 and AzanOBP7)of A.zanthoxylum were cloned,and the 5’ and 3’ non-coding regions were identified.According to bioinformatics analysis,it was found that the amino Agrilus mali acid sequences of the three genes had high homology with the odor binding protein,among which AzanOBP4 and AzanOBP5 belonged to the Classic OBP family,and AzanOBP7 belonged to the Minus-C OBP family.2.All three genes expressed in different tissues(head,thorax,abdomen,feet and wings)of A.zanthoxylum,AzanOBP7 with the highest relative expression,followed by AzanOBP5 and AzanOBP4.In female adults,the expression of Aznan OBP4 in feet(P=0.000)and wings(P=0.018),AzanOBP5 in abdomen(P=0.001),feet(P=0.002)and wings(P=0.001),AzanOBP7 in wings(P= 0.001).In male adults,only the expression of gene AzanOBP7 in abdomen(P=0.000)was significantly higher than that in female.3.The prokaryotic expression vectors AzanOBPs/p ET-21 a of AzanOBP4,AzanOBP5 and AzanOBP7 were successfully constructed and the fusion protein His-AzanOBPs expressed in vitro was obtained.Two fusion proteins His-AzanOBP5 and His-AzanOBP7 were successfully purified and expressed in the supernatant.Western Blot verified that the purified fusion protein was the target protein.4.With the method of folding recognition,the three-dimensional models of protein AzanOBP4,AzanOBP5 and AzanOBP7 with fittable model quality were constructed with Amel OBP5,Agam OBP20 and Dmel GOBP1 as main templates.5.Semi-flexible docking was carried out with three A.zanthoxylum narrow-ginning proteins AzanOBP4,AzanOBP5 and AzanOBP7 as receptors and 46 host volatiles detected in the early stage of laboratory as ligands.Among them,the binding energy between AzanOBP4 and host volatiles was concentrated in-8.7 ~-3.9 k J/mol.The binding energy between AzanOBP5 and host volatiles ranged from-7.0 to-3.8 k J/mol.The binding energy of AzanOBP7 to host volatiles ranged from-7.1 k J/mol to-3.8 k J/mol.According to the overall binding energy,AzanOBP4 had better binding ability with host volatiles.Odor-binding protein was combined with host volatile receptor through hydrogen bonding,van der Waals force and hydrophobic interaction,but van der Waals force and hydrophobic interaction were more important.β-caryophyllene,humulene,trans-2-hexenal and trans-2-hexene-1-ol were screened out,which can be used as the formulation components of green chemicals for preventing and controlling A.zanthoxylum.The research results of odor binding protein of A.zanthoxylum were helpful to explore the molecular interaction mechanism between A.zanthoxylum and its host volatiles.Also study provided theoretical guidance for green prevention and control of A.zanthoxylum.
